The switch is located in the armrest of the rear seat.
To adjust the position of front passenger’s seat ;
Press the control switch forward (1) or rearward (2) to move the seat to the desired position.
Press the control switch forward (3) or rearward (4) to move the seatback to the desired angle.
Do not use these switches while the front passenger seat is occupied.
